Manufacturing Maintenance Job Description:
- Troubleshoot, maintain, and repair all lab and production equipment:
- molding machines, mixers, extrusion machines, forklifts, floor scrubbers, etc.
- typical building / facility upkeep
- Responsibilities include: light hydraulics, pneumatics, metal fabrication, welding, forklift repair, electrical troubleshooting and electrical repair.
- Daily duties include:
- forklift inspection, documentation, and repair if necessary
- documentation on log sheets of all shift maintenance activity
- work orders completed and are turned in for all assigned or emergency repairs completed
- passing along information pertaining to all work order/in-process job status during shift transition.
- Perform preventative maintenance on all lab and production equipment as assigned
- Address machine or equipment repair status with shift Production Supervisor.
- Ensure maintenance areas are kept clean throughout the shifts, and ready for shift transition.
Manufacturing Maintenance Job Requirements:
- High school diploma or equivalent, with 2-3 years Generalist experience working as maintenance mechanic
- Experience in a plastics industry environment preferred (extrusion or injection machines)
- Experience includes: hydraulics, pneumatics, metal fabrication and welding, electrical diagnostics, trouble shooting, wiring, repair, and forklift repair, etc
- Excellent verbal and legible written communication skills as they pertain to dealing with and understanding employee machine malfunction concerns or issues, and documenting job progress in logs.
